Vaillant Mechanical Vibration / Loose Components

Indoor unit makes loud rattling or buzzing noises during operation

Advertisements

Possible Causes

Loose indoor fan housing screws, Blower wheel out of balance due to dirt, Loose front panel or filter, Vibrating copper pipes touching the casing

How to Fix / Troubleshooting

Safety: Turn off power before removing covers.

  • Check front panel and filters: Ensure the front panel is fully latched and filters are properly seated.
  • Tighten screws: Remove the front cover and gently tighten visible screws securing the fan housing and PCB bracket.
  • Inspect blower wheel: Look for heavy dust buildup or foreign objects in the blower. Clean carefully with a brush and vacuum.
  • Secure piping: If copper pipes are touching the plastic casing, insert foam or rubber spacers to prevent vibration noise.
  • Test: Restore power and run the unit. If noise persists, the blower wheel may be cracked or the motor bearings worn and should be replaced.
